Output 3783c7949c28de8e1b42d8a7e90f78df81dbe6212caa538068eead936de8fd17:2

value
18868692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e16082ff6a2d723e4a88b9bf9e35a855bfa269ea OP_EQUAL
address
MUSqtLrkEEf5YFNsB4KSw9BvLEYeeY8gbx
transaction
3783c7949c28de8e1b42d8a7e90f78df81dbe6212caa538068eead936de8fd17
spent
true